Output 53aacf43cba96738f14784608ad1ef3808999a6c9017f9afb42ad8787e791e9e:1

value
21016464
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b48a0f48daf8a3d6551218ec0856deefa11fd88c OP_EQUALVERIFY OP_CHECKSIG
address
1HTc25zEKycUvRDnC7VD1gtPeYpYMZEhZR
transaction
53aacf43cba96738f14784608ad1ef3808999a6c9017f9afb42ad8787e791e9e
spent
true